Transaction 3402967793c9f46030d99ffbfb847acb63e77693d6e7e8a943ccc5fcb3da995f

3 Input
2 Outputs
  • 3402967793c9f46030d99ffbfb847acb63e77693d6e7e8a943ccc5fcb3da995f:0
  • value  1023235
    address  1McePZPsw6m1dw7fCizCcxCsubMRuzZkjs
  • 3402967793c9f46030d99ffbfb847acb63e77693d6e7e8a943ccc5fcb3da995f:1
  • value  1959
    address  14fBbymcb2s82uXyxiwqD8x1X8cAiHfjtf